The high strength steel market in Germany is experiencing robust growth driven by the demand for lightweight, high-performance materials in automotive, construction, energy, and infrastructure sectors. High strength steels, characterized by enhanced mechanical properties such as tensile strength, yield strength, and toughness, offer significant advantages in terms of structural efficiency, material savings, and design flexibility compared to conventional steels. In Germany, automotive manufacturers are increasingly adopting advanced high strength steels (AHSS) for vehicle lightweighting initiatives to improve fuel efficiency, crashworthiness, and sustainability. Moreover, the construction sector is leveraging high strength steels for high-rise buildings, bridges, and infrastructure projects to enhance structural resilience and reduce environmental footprint. Market players are investing in research and development to develop innovative steel grades, manufacturing processes, and surface treatments to meet the evolving performance requirements of end-users in the Germany market.

Playing a vital role in automotive, construction, and manufacturing sectors, the Germany High Strength Steel Market faces challenges related to materials innovation, manufacturing processes, and market dynamics. One pressing challenge is the need to develop steel grades with enhanced strength, toughness, and formability to meet lightweighting and performance requirements, while ensuring cost competitiveness and sustainability. This necessitates investments in alloy development, heat treatment technologies, and process optimizations to achieve desired properties without compromising on quality or processability. Additionally, addressing supply chain vulnerabilities and price volatilities in raw materials poses a persistent challenge for steel producers and end-users, requiring strategic sourcing and risk management strategies. Moreover, navigating trade uncertainties and competitive pressures amidst globalization requires agility and adaptability in market positioning and product differentiation.
